The Stellenbosch University Choir conducted by André van der Merwe presents a series of concerts in May.
The 2014 repertoire includes music which the choir will present at the World Choir Games in Riga in July this year. Various musical styles, including African music and new compositions will be presented.
The World Choir Games is hosted by Interkultur and is the biggest competition for choirs in the world – more than 500 choirs from all over the world have entered for this competition in Riga. South Africa will be represented by 18 choirs. Currently the Stellenbosch University is ranked number one on the Interkultur list for the top 1000 international choirs.
